Output 589037a2062177c25a63f502fffd1d641ecdd7ff21b1cce3bde1799eaf416286:1

value
76499004
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 c873151069948c68a8be648038b4dfc0247e7fba OP_EQUALVERIFY OP_CHECKSIG
address
1KGt1RYdYQdDKegFmqqcMsPk8bV7fHEcAp
transaction
589037a2062177c25a63f502fffd1d641ecdd7ff21b1cce3bde1799eaf416286
confirmations
388743
spent
true